The events of October 16 indicate a serious divsion of opinion; if as the Prime Minister of Indonesia states the division is not in the Cabinet but in the country that makes the situation all the graver. [...] But a Government without a strong folloing in the country is in no position to wrestle with the army chiefs or even to meet with the political influence of the Sultan of Jodjakarta who has the backing of the Masjumi and Socialist elements in the Cabinet.
